Ministry Teams Disability Team (DMT)
The HYACKs Disability Ministry Team is designed to provide the student with an introduction to serving people with disabilities. A biblical foundation provides the student with God’s view of the disabled and enhances Christ-centered attitudes and motivations for fellowship and service. Students are given opportunities to interact with health care professionals and with families affected by disability within the framework of the STARS Disability Ministry at College Church in Wheaton. Student leaders will be presented with opportunities to provide organizational leadership for Disability Ministry Team service activities and for HYACK-wide ministry events. Goal: Students will understand that persons with disabilities are an indispensable part of the body of Christ and will help carry out Christ’s mandate to bring persons with disabilities into the body of Christ.

I am interested in missions. What do I do next? The Missionary Preparation Program answers that question. It takes people at any time, at any stage in life, at any age, and gives them a plan–action steps–for what they can do to prepare themselves for cross-cultural ministry.
Why prepare missionaries? People are the means of carrying the good news of Christ to every nation. If we are going to send our best, we are responsible to train them well for the work of world evangelism.
It is our hope that the Missionary Preparation Program will develop God-centered, compassionate, well-prepared and highly motivated people to do the work of missions. It is designed for everyone who wants to grow as a world Christian, but the Missionary Preparation Program is especially for those considering short-term or career missions. Participants work through five dimensions of growth and preparation in the context of a mentoring relationship. Expect to grow in character, knowledge and ministry skills.
